What Causes Profuse Sweating And Breathing Difficulty Upon Climbing Stairs?

I am female, 59years old. This weekend was climbing up several stairs and had to stop frequently for a good period of time. I was sweating profusely, nauseous, out of breath and couldn t seem to catch my breath, could feel my heart beating and hear it inside my ears, felt I could have diarrhea and thought I could throw up, I felt terrible to where I seriously wasn t sure I was going to be able to make it up the rest of the stairs. Is this normal or something I should be concerned about? About a year ago when climbing up hill, I experienced the exact same thing. Thank you!!
